Great news for anyone planning a break soon because Dublin Airport has just welcomed a new airline and a new route to their schedule.
Austrian budget airline Laudamotion has just introduced a new daily service between Dublin and Vienna.
The direct flight will operate year-round with an Airbus A320 aircraft and flights can be booked via their section on the Ryanair site.
Prices start from just €9.99 one way meaning it’s an ideal spot for a winter weekend getaway.
Partly owned by former Formula 1 racing driver Niki Lauda, Laudamotion is Dublin’s fifth new airline customer this year.
Dublin Airport Managing Director Vincent Harrison said, “Vienna is a beautiful city that is rich in culture and history and I have no doubt it will be a very popular destination.”
